$101KLet's green california - in 2024 the leaders of our project continued to work with labor leaders, environmentalists, and environmental justice activists to establish labor standards in the community choice energy agencies in the bay area and central california. By joining with labor to support these standards, we encouraged the building of trust and communication between the three communities. The success of these efforts persuaded a large california environmental organization to incorporate our team into their program. We facilitated that transition, knowing that the success of climate policies in california depends on labor being at the table. Our strategic work with labor in central california since 2016 will now be taken throughout the state. California continues to be a state that could create a model of equitable climate policies that can be replicated worldwide.knowing that members of low to moderate income communities need education on why electric cars and electric kitchens are more economical and healthy for children and families, we also continued our program with the monterey catholic diocese. Working with diocesan leaders and leaders in local parishes in predominantly hispanic communities, we brought in experts, kitchen equipment, and electric cars. We provided food cooked on electric stoves and rides in the electric cars. We generated gatherings after church services and educated parishioners on how to receive financial incentives for purchasing these items, and how important the health benefits were compared to natural gas stoves and gasoline cars.

$352KSpecial media project - is a research and investigative project that is preparing to produce a publicly available archive, a 24-episode podcast series, a documentary series, and a cable series about the legal, investigative, and organizing activities of the christic institute and the romero institute. The research covers 50 years of public interest work and reveals important historical information that is relevant today to illuminate systemic injustice in corporate and government corruption, human and civil rights violations, criminal activity, constitutional violations, drug smuggling, and illegal war making. The romero institute archival project seeks to correct the historical record and provide credible facts in several media formats. The goal is to share true facts that beg for new laws and policies needed to create a sustainable, green, and thriving future for the u.s. And the world.
